Optimizing Carbohydrate Intake for Female Sprinters
Carbohydrates are a vital energy source for female sprinters, especially in disciplines like track and field. Sprinting events demand quick bursts of energy, which rely heavily on glycogen stores in the muscles. Proper carbohydrate intake allows female athletes to enhance their performance, recover effectively, and maintain overall health. It’s crucial for female sprinters to understand the types of carbohydrates they consume and how these impact their energy levels. The timing of carbohydrate consumption is equally important. For optimal results, female sprinters should incorporate carbohydrates into their pre-training and post-training meals. This not only boosts energy during workouts but also aids in recovery post-exercise. Additionally, choosing complex carbohydrates such as whole grains, fruits, and vegetables is advisable for sustained energy. Simple carbohydrates can provide quick energy, but it’s important not to rely on them excessively as they can lead to energy crashes. Maintaining a balanced diet rich in carbohydrates is essential for female sprinters aiming for peak performance and competitive success. Understanding the role of hydration in combination with carbohydrate intake is essential for female sprinters. Proper hydration helps maintain optimal muscle function and performance during intense training sessions and competitions. Female athletes often overlook the importance of fluid intake, despite its crucial role in energy metabolism. Dehydration can lead to reduced performance, increased fatigue, and potential injuries. Female sprinters can benefit greatly by creating a hydration plan that aligns with their carbohydrate consumption, matching fluid intake with exercise intensity and duration. During workouts, it is vital to consume fluids containing electrolytes, especially if training intensifies for an extended period. Recommendations suggest drinking water and electrolyte drinks pre, during, and post-exercise, based on sweat rates and environmental conditions. Additionally, adapting fluid intake to seasonal climate changes is vital for maintaining performance. Female sprinters should also pay attention to urine color as an indicator of hydration status. Clear or light yellow urine indicates proper hydration, while dark urine signals a need for increased fluid intake. Macronutrient Ratios for Female Sprinters
When planning meals, macronutrient ratios must be tailored to each female sprinter’s training regime, workload, and individual nutritional needs. Carbohydrate-rich diets typically constitute 55-65% of total daily calories for athletes. This proportion supports maintaining glycogen stores, essential for sprint performance. Protein, making up 15-20% of total intake, is crucial for muscle repair and recovery. Healthy fats should account for roughly 20-30% of total daily calories, providing essential fatty acids and energy. Optimizing these ratios based on training phases, such as endurance versus power training, allows female athletes to adapt their dietary needs strategically. For instance, during intense sprint training, focusing on higher carbohydrate intake is essential to replenish glycogen stores affected by high-intensity workouts. During tapering phases leading up to competitions, adjusting carbohydrate intake can enhance muscle glycogen storage, preparing the body for peak performance. Supplementation is another significant consideration within the realm of nutrition for female sprinters. While a well-rounded diet should deliver most necessary nutrients, supplements can fill in any gaps or enhance performance. Commonly used supplements include protein powders, amino acids, and specific vitamins or minerals that may be deficient in an athlete’s diet. For instance, iron is vital for female athletes due to increased needs and potential blood loss during menstrual cycles. Therefore, iron supplementation can be advantageous for maintaining hemoglobin levels and overall energy. Other valuable supplements, such as creatine and beta-alanine, may improve sprint performance and recovery, thus benefiting track athletes significantly. However, it cautions against relying solely on supplements as a substitute for a balanced diet. Athletes should prioritize food sources first and consult with a healthcare provider before initiating any new supplement regimen. Diet Planning for Training Cycles
Effective diet planning for female sprinters involves aligning carbohydrate intake with training cycles. For instance, during heavy training weeks, female sprinters should emphasize high carbohydrate intake to replenish glycogen stores post workouts. Incorporating more carbohydrate dense meal options can not only enhance recovery but also prepare the body for upcoming physical demands. As training intensity tapers, reducing carbohydrate intake slightly while maintaining protein and fat ratios is beneficial for overall health. On rest days, balancing macronutrient intake can prevent excessive calorie consumption while supporting recovery. Pre-competition meals should center around easily digestible carbohydrates, allowing maximum energy for sprint events. Female athletes often experiment with various foods to find what sits well before races, as individual responses differ. Key considerations include meal timing, with a focus on consuming carbohydrates around two to four hours before competition. Post-competition meals should also contain carbohydrates, and proteins to facilitate recovery and muscle repair. Incorporating diverse and nutrient-dense foods into the diets of female sprinters is critical for enhancing athletic performance. Whole grains, fruits, and vegetables should form the backbone of these diets while also providing necessary fiber and micronutrients. Foods rich in antioxidants can aid in recovery by reducing oxidative stress from intense workouts. This is where colorful fruits and vegetables shine, providing essential vitamins and minerals crucial for performance. Lean proteins, such as chicken, fish, tofu, and legumes, aid muscle synthesis and recovery and should be a regular component of meals. Additionally, healthy fats from nuts, seeds, avocados, and olive oil provide long-lasting energy to fuel workouts. Careful consideration of food combinations can enhance nutrient absorption; for example, combining iron-rich foods with vitamin C sources like citrus can improve iron uptake.
